We are looking for a Senior Business Analyst to help define and shape software solutions for our healthcare clients. You will bridge the gap between business/clinical stakeholders and the delivery team, translating complex healthcare workflows and regulatory requirements into clear, actionable specifications. This role suits someone comfortable working with both business owners and clinicians, and who can navigate the regulatory and data-sensitivity constraints specific to healthcare software.

Responsibilities:

  • Elicit, analyze, and document business, functional, system, and non-functional requirements from healthcare stakeholders (clinical staff, administrators, payers, or IT teams), through interviews, workshops, and process observation.
  • Translate requirements into clear artifacts: user stories, use cases, acceptance criteria, BRDs/FRDs, SRSs, process flows, wireframes, and functional specifications that development and QA teams can act on.
  • Map and analyze existing clinical and administrative workflows, identifying gaps, inefficiencies, and opportunities for improvement.
  • Perform business and system analysis and contribute to solution design together with solution architects, technical leads, and development teams.
  • Define integration requirements and collaborate with technical teams on APIs, data flows, and external/internal system integrations.
  • Work closely with solution architects and developers to validate that proposed solutions meet business needs and regulatory requirements.
  • Support compliance analysis, ensuring requirements account for relevant healthcare regulations and standards (e.g., HIPAA, FDA, GDPR, HL7/FHIR interoperability requirements where applicable).
  • Prioritize and manage the product/requirements backlog in collaboration with the Project Manager and/or Product Owner.
  • Support backlog refinement, planning, requirements clarification, and delivery activities.
  • Facilitate communication between business stakeholders and technical teams throughout the project lifecycle, clarifying requirements and resolving ambiguities.
  • Support UAT/SIT planning and execution, ensuring delivered functionality matches documented requirements.
  • Support issue analysis and requirements clarification throughout implementation and delivery.
  • Prepare presentations, project materials, and documentation for business and technical stakeholders.
  • Support business users during implementation, go-live, and adoption of new solutions.
  • Contribute to pre-sales and discovery activities for healthcare opportunities, including requirements discovery, scoping, estimations, and solution discussions.
  • Work directly with prospective customers to understand business needs, challenges, and expectations.
  • Collaborate with Sales/Account Managers, Project Managers, Solution Architects, and technical experts during the presales stage.
  • Support the preparation of proposals, estimates, assumptions, presentations, and other presales materials, and participate in customer presentations and solution discussions when required.
